Please Print to PDF Before Sending to Insurance Agents

Inter Nachi - Wed, 05/29/2013 - 00:01
Hello Inspectors,

If you are using a fillable form to complete you Wind Mitigations, you need to print them as PDF prior to sending them. If the fillable form is sent out, it can be altered by anyone. It also confuses the agents. (That's how I get the call).
